Step-by-Step Guide to Using UV Flashlights at Crime Scenes
UV flashlights are essential tools in crime scene investigations, helping uncover evidence such as bodily fluids, fingerprints, and fibers that are invisible under normal lighting. This guide offers a detailed, step-by-step approach to using UV flashlights in forensic applications, complete with tips, comparisons, and precautions. Why Use UV Flashlights at Crime Scenes? UV light reveals substances that fluoresce under ultraviolet wavelengths. These can include organic materials, chemical residues, and synthetic fibers, which are often pivotal in solving cases.
